§ 90.09 KEEPING OF DANGEROUS ANIMALS.
   No person shall have a right of property in, keep, harbor, care for, act as custodian of or maintain in his or her possession any dangerous animal or primate except at a properly maintained zoological park, federally licensed exhibit, circus, college or university, scientific institution, research laboratory, veterinary hospital, licensed hound running area (ILCS Ch. 520, Act 5, § 3.26), or animal refuge in an escape-proof enclosure. It is no defense that the person violating this section has attempted to domesticate the dangerous animal or primate.
(Ord. 2012-42, passed 12-10-2012) Penalty, see § 90.99
